IC 24-15-2-7: "Consent"

Sec. 7. (a) "Consent" means a clear affirmative act that signifies a consumer's freely given, specific, informed, and unambiguous agreement to process personal data relating to the consumer.

(b) For purposes of this section, a "clear affirmative act" includes a written statement, including a statement written by electronic means, or any other unambiguous affirmative action.
